I have a 9" South Bend lathe with the motor underneath and it needs a
new belt. I have heard that there is a seamed belt that goes together
with a velcro type seam but I have not been able to find one in any
search. Does anyone know of a source for this type of belt?



I, too, replaced my clickclickclick leather belt when it finally went
on the 9" SouthBend. Used an automobile serpentine belt. Cut it to
length and then stitched it together with the heaviest monofilament
fishing line laying around. Kept the line in between the grooves of
the belt. Nice and quiet and has been running for a year now.
BTW- Don't forget to release the belt tension when you are not using
the machine regardless of material.
